Charcoal-Broiled Duck Breasts


4 md Duck breast filets
1 tb Sherry
4 sl Bacon
1 tb Brandy
2 Beef bouilllon cubes
1/8 ts Marjoram
1 c Water
1/8 ts Oregano
1 tb Red Current jelly
Grated rind of 1 orange
1/2 ts Dry mustard

1) Rinse the duck breasts and pat dry, then wrap each filet with a slice of bacon (same as for a filet mignon) and season with salt and pepper to taste. Grill over hot coals for exactly 2 minutes per side...

2) Disolve the bouillon cubes in water in a chaffing dish or electric skillet, and stir in the jelly, mustard, sherry, brandy, and spices, simmering `til thickened. Stir in the orange rind and add the filets...

3) Cook for 5 min. or `til med rare, basting constantly
